As an authoritarian state, the Chinese government needs to adapt its policies and make them more effective in serving local development requirements. With this in mind, Xi Jinping has introduced "new-style think tanks with Chinese characteristics" capable of facilitating the formulation, introduction, and adaptation of new policies.
